Critics from The A.V. Club and Sopranos Autopsy note that the episode highlights the characters' inability to succeed outside their comfort zones. Artie cannot be a "tough guy" without consequences, and Christopher cannot be a Hollywood player despite his connections.

Christopher and Little Carmine travel to Los Angeles to recruit Sir Ben Kingsley for their film project, Cleaver . Christopher becomes obsessed with the "luxury lounge" gift suites, where celebrities receive massive amounts of free high-end merchandise ("swag"). After being rejected by Kingsley, a desperate and relapse-prone Christopher mugs legendary actress Lauren Bacall for her gift bag.

The episode follows two parallel storylines exploring characters who feel excluded from worlds they believe they deserve to inhabit.
